    "content": "Add testpmd support for the rte_flow_pattern_template and\nrte_flow_actions_template APIs. Provide the command line interface\nfor the template creation/destruction. Usage example:\n  testpmd> flow pattern_template 0 create pattern_template_id 2\n           template eth dst is 00:16:3e:31:15:c3 / end\n  testpmd> flow actions_template 0 create actions_template_id 4\n           template drop / end mask drop / end\n  testpmd> flow actions_template 0 destroy actions_template 4\n  testpmd> flow pattern_template 0 destroy pattern_template 2\n\nSigned-off-by: Alexander Kozyrev <akozyrev@nvidia.com>\nAcked-by: Ori Kam <orika@nvidia.com>\n---\n app/test-pmd/cmdline_flow.c                 | 376 +++++++++++++++++++-\n app/test-pmd/config.c                       | 203 +++++++++++\n app/test-pmd/testpmd.h                      |  23 ++\n doc/guides/testpmd_app_ug/testpmd_funcs.rst |  97 +++++\n 4 files changed, 697 insertions(+), 2 deletions(-)",

validate {port_id}\n@@ -3447,6 +3465,85 @@ Otherwise it will show an error message of the form::\n \n    Caught error type [...] ([...]): [...]\n \n+Creating pattern templates\n+~~~~~~~~~~~~~~~~~~~~~~~~~~\n+\n+``flow pattern_template create`` creates the specified pattern template.\n+It is bound to ``rte_flow_pattern_template_create()``::\n+\n+   flow pattern_template {port_id} create [pattern_template_id {id}]\n+       [relaxed {boolean}] template {item} [/ {item} [...]] / end\n+\n+If successful, it will show::\n+\n+   Pattern template #[...] created\n+\n+Otherwise it will show an error message of the form::\n+\n+   Caught error type [...] ([...]): [...]\n+\n+This command uses the same pattern items as ``flow create``,\n+their format is described in `Creating flow rules`_.\n+\n+Destroying pattern templates\n+~~~~~~~~~~~~~~~~~~~~~~~~~~~~\n+\n+``flow pattern_template destroy`` destroys one or more pattern templates\n+from their template ID (as returned by ``flow pattern_template create``),\n+this command calls ``rte_flow_pattern_template_destroy()`` as many\n+times as necessary::\n+\n+   flow pattern_template {port_id} destroy pattern_template {id} [...]\n+\n+If successful, it will show::\n+\n+   Pattern template #[...] destroyed\n+\n+It does not report anything for pattern template IDs that do not exist.\n+The usual error message is shown when a pattern template cannot be destroyed::\n+\n+   Caught error type [...] ([...]): [...]\n+\n+Creating actions templates\n+~~~~~~~~~~~~~~~~~~~~~~~~~~\n+\n+``flow actions_template create`` creates the specified actions template.\n+It is bound to ``rte_flow_actions_template_create()``::\n+\n+   flow actions_template {port_id} create [actions_template_id {id}]\n+       template {action} [/ {action} [...]] / end\n+       mask {action} [/ {action} [...]] / end\n+\n+If successful, it will show::\n+\n+   Actions template #[...] created\n+\n+Otherwise it will show an error message of the form::\n+\n+   Caught error type [...] ([...]): [...]\n+\n+This command uses the same actions as ``flow create``,\n+their format is described in `Creating flow rules`_.\n+\n+Destroying actions templates\n+~~~~~~~~~~~~~~~~~~~~~~~~~~~~\n+\n+``flow actions_template destroy`` destroys one or more actions templates\n+from their template ID (as returned by ``flow actions_template create``),\n+this command calls ``rte_flow_actions_template_destroy()`` as many\n+times as necessary::\n+\n+   flow actions_template {port_id} destroy actions_template {id} [...]\n+\n+If successful, it will show::\n+\n+   Actions template #[...] destroyed\n+\n+It does not report anything for actions template IDs that do not exist.\n+The usual error message is shown when an actions template cannot be destroyed::\n+\n+   Caught error type [...] ([...]): [...]\n+\n Creating a tunnel stub for offload\n 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~\n \n",
